Output 59bb4c78df11ec8a0893f8087e7ceeb5e5ef364c301aa35c127919160096d0de:0

value
6062
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 265dc8d9548556ddf1835d7b9fa0cb32d412466e614176aee2911dd5936fe027
address
bc1pyewu3k25s4tdmuvrt4aelgxtxt2py3nwv9qhdthzjywatym0uqnspfgs9r
transaction
59bb4c78df11ec8a0893f8087e7ceeb5e5ef364c301aa35c127919160096d0de
spent
true